Koherenssihäviö, known in English as coherence loss or decoherence, refers to the loss of quantum coherence in a quantum system. Quantum coherence is a fundamental property of quantum mechanics that allows a quantum system to exist in a superposition of multiple states simultaneously. This property is essential for phenomena like quantum entanglement and quantum computing.
